Patriotic Party Picks at www.food.com

  • 18 1/4 ounces white cake mix
  • 1 cup water (or as indicated on cake mix directions)
  • 1/3 cup oil (or as indicated on cake mix directions)
  • 3 eggs (or as indicated on cake mix directions)
  • 1/2 teaspoon blue food coloring
  • 1/2 teaspoon red food coloring
  • 1 (16 ounce) can vanilla frosting
  • red white and blue candy sprinkles

Directions:


  1. Prepare cake mix according to package directions.
  2. In a small bowl, combine 1 1/3 cups batter with blue food coloring. In another small bowl, combine red food coloring with 1 1/3 cups batter. Leave the remaining batter plain.
  3. Fill paper-lined muffin tins with 2 tablespoons red batter, 2 tablespoons plain batter, and 2 tablespoons blue batter. Do not swirl batter, leave it layered.
  4. Bake at 350ºF for 20-24 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in a cupcake comes out clean.
  5. Cool 10 minutes in pan and then remove cupcakes to a wire rack to cool completely.
  6. Frost with vanilla frosting and decorate with sprinkles.

    • 3 ounces cranberry juice or 3 ounces fruit punch
    • 3 ounces Gatorade sports drink (blue)
    • 3 ounces sugar free 7-Up or 3 ounces Sprite
    • ice cube, fill glass to the top with cubes

    Directions:


    1. Place the ice cubes in the bottom 3rd of a tall 12 ounce clear glass. Pour the cranberry juice or fruit punch in to fill the bottom 3rd.
    2. Place a few more cubes in to the middle and pour in the blue Gatorade to fill the glass 2/3 full.
    3. Place the final 3rd of ice in the glass. Pour in the diet 7up or diet Sprite.
    4. Serve and enjoy!
